On Tue, Dec 21, 2004 at 09:08:07PM +0200, sasha wrote:
> I would like to create a package from port (for example OpenOffice) to
> install one on other computer without network. How to do this?

After install:

cd /usr/ports/<category>/<port>
make package

You may want to use make package-recursive as that makes packages of all
the dependencies as well.
